noun
1. : any of several aggressively weedy sedges of the genus Cyperus; especially : a perennial sedge (C. rotundus) of wide distribution having slender rootstocks that bear small edible nutlike tubers
2. : any of several American sedges of the genus Scleria

* * *

either of two sedges, Cyperus rotundus or C. esculentus, that have small, nutlike tubers and are often troublesome weeds. Also called nut sedge.
[1765-75, Amer.]
